How do you size a Dresden plate?

The size is set by the blade length, blade width, and the finished diameter of the circle. First decide the final block size, then choose a template that matches that measurement. A larger plate needs longer blades and a wider center opening, while a smaller one uses shorter pieces. Many quilters test one paper or fabric sample before cutting the full set. In a dresden plate template PDF, the printed scale should be checked with a ruler before use.

How many blades for a Dresden plate quilt block?

Most blocks use 12, 16, or 20 blades, depending on the look and the size of the finished block. Twelve blades give a classic, open fan shape with wider petals. Sixteen blades create a fuller circle and a more detailed edge. The number can be adjusted, but all blades must be identical for the block to sit flat. A dresden plate template usually states the blade count clearly, which helps match the design to the project.

How to attach a Dresden plate to fabric?

The blades are usually attached by placing them in a circle on the base fabric and stitching them down with a straight seam or applique method. Edges can be folded under and secured by hand with a blind stitch, or fixed by machine with a narrow zigzag or applique stitch. The center circle covers the inner points and hides the joins. A printed dresden plate template helps keep the spacing even before sewing starts.

What is the angle of the Dresden plate?

The angle is commonly around 18 degrees for a 20-blade plate, but it changes with the number of blades used. Fewer blades need a wider angle; more blades use a narrower one. The angle is what allows the blades to fit into a full circle without gaps or overlap. A dresden plate template PDF usually includes the correct angle already built into the pattern, which avoids manual calculation and keeps the block balanced.
